Rushville, Il vs Kalgoorlie, Western Australia Climate & Distance Between

Australia flag
  • The distance between Rushville, Il, Usa and Kalgoorlie, Western Australia, Australia is approximately 16,920 km or 10,514 mi.
  • To reach Rushville, Il in this distance one would set out from Kalgoorlie, Western Australia bearing 61.7°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Rushville, Il bearing 99.1° or E .
  • Rushville, Il has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Kalgoorlie, Western Australia has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h).
  • Rushville, Il is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Kalgoorlie, Western Australia is in or near the subtropical desert scrub bi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 7.7 °C (13.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 14.5 °C (26.1°F) more in Rushville, Il.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 742.9 mm (29.2 in) more which is equivalent to 742.9 l/m² (18.23 US gal/ft²) or 7,429,000 l/ha (794,209 US gal/ac) more. About 3 3/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.5° lower in Rushville, Il than in Kalgoorlie, Western Australia.
